Generally speaking, the two primary uses for a sling is to carry the gun, and the other is to serve as an aid during off hand shooting. The first is almost a no brainer and can be done ever how you want, and with what ever style of sling you want. The second however, requires training/understanding/mastering of the what's/why's/how's which are involved in order to obtain the desired results, which in turn is going to dictate "which style" of sling you'll need...which just in passing, probably ain't what you're seeing those "young LEO's" wearing around their neck.
On the other hand, if all you're wanting is some way to keep the gun on your person while awaiting your turn to disconnect it and commence shooting, and/or if all you are doing is shooting off of a bench, it don't much matter what sling you use in the mean time...
I mean really, as a practical matter...if it's not going to be used (or attached) while shooting, how much difference can one sling possibly make over another?...just go with whatever suits you.
